Hi Robert, I would like to take part in the coming osgIntrospection library, either as a contributor or a leader. I have experience maintaining projects with SVN. But the problem is that I'm not an osgIntrospection user and don't have a comprehensive idea of the future of this library. So just consider me as a volunteer if there were not enough people attending this new project. :)
If possible, maybe what I'm going to do is to merge the wrapper and related examples (there is a Tcl/Tk example besides examples/osgintrospection) first, and see if we can have an easy-to-use front-end in the next step. This is also helpful in developing the reflection mechanism using serializers. Cheers, Wang Rui 2010/6/22 Robert Osfield <[email protected]> > Hi All, > > As part of my prep work of the OSG for the up coming 3.0 I will be > moving osgIntrospection and the associated wrappers out into their > separate project, and looking for a member of the OSG community to > step up and take over management of this project. My thought is that > one would place the osgIntrospection library, the introspection > wrappers and the genwrapper tool into this project, with something > like the following structure: > > > > ProjectName/include/osgIntrospection > ProjectName/src/osgIntrospection > > ProjectName/src/genwrapper > > ProjectName/src/osgWrappers/osg/ > ProjectName/src/osgWrappers/osgDB > ProjectName/src/osgWrappers/osgUtil > ... > > The osgIntrospection library itself could actually be renamed as it is > actually OSG specific - it was written by Marco Jez to be able to wrap > any C++ project, so could easily be rename to something like > cppIntrospection/introspection,or whatever the new project lead feels > appropriate. genwrapper is also not specific to OSG. > > The only part that need be specific to the OSG is the wrappers that > genwrapper generates, potentially this could even be maintained as > another separate project, so you have a generic library and > application for generating wrappers, then you have the prebuilt OSG > wrappers. > > I would like parties that use osgIntrospeciton to come forward on what > they would like to do with project and also for individuals/groups to > come forward and volunteer to lead/contribute to this project. Once > we get some consensus I'll package up the project in a way that makes > it appropriate to pick up and take the reigns on. > > I would like to inject some urgency into this effort as my plan for > the next developer release of the OpenSceneGaph (2.9.9) is for it to > be made with osgIntrospection already moved out, and would like to > make 2.9.9 in the next week to ten days. My desire to get the ball > rolling on this is that I'm shaping up the OSG dev release series for > the 3.0 stable release, to be made this summer. > > Thanks in advance for your help, > > Robert. > _______________________________________________ > osg-users mailing list > [email protected] > http://lists.openscenegraph.org/listinfo.cgi/osg-users-openscenegraph.org >
_______________________________________________ osg-users mailing list [email protected] http://lists.openscenegraph.org/listinfo.cgi/osg-users-openscenegraph.org

